help with computer
 
help please

my friends computer turns on and boots up ok but no icons come on the desktop. We cant get any start menu and yet we can get Windows Task Manager and from there we can get web pages and into the computer.

Sounds very symptomatic of a nasty bit of spyware called Smitfraud. Try this anyway and see what happens. Its worth a try and wont harm your system any further even if it doesnt work...

First of all download the program SmitRem.exe by clicking this :

http://noahdfear.geekstogo.com/click...click.php?id=1

Extract the 4 files and then run the file RunThis.Bat file by doubleclicking it. When its gone through, reboot and see if you can right click on ya desktop again and re-tick the show desktop icons option.

If that doesnt make your icons come back or you still cant right click after running SmitRem and rebooting, try going to this site :

http://www.kellys-korner-xp.com/xp_tweaks.htm

Go down the page to line number 128 and on the right hand side you will see an option for Restore Desktop and Screensaver tabs. Just click it, click Run and say yes to the registry alteration then fingers crossed you will be able to right click on the desktop once more..
